Body
Origins and Family
Dominik Moll's place of birth was Bühl[2]. He was born on May 7, 1962[3].
Education
Educated at Institut des hautes études cinématographiques[10], a film school[26], in France[27], founded in 1943[28] and City University of New York[11], a public university[29], in United States[30], founded in 1961[31], headquartered in New York City[32].

Recognition
Awards received include César Award for Best Director[12], a César Award[33], in France[34], founded in 1976[35] and César Award for Best Adaptation[13], a César Award[36], in France[37], founded in 1983[38].
